Method

  1. Begin by dusting all surfaces using a microfibre cloth to capture dust particles effectively.
  2. Sanitise high-touch areas using a disinfectant spray and a clean cloth, ensuring all surfaces are visibly wet for the contact time specified by the product.
  3. Vacuum carpets and mats using a vacuum cleaner with a HEPA filter to minimise airborne dust.
  4. Mop hard floors with a neutral pH floor cleaner, using a colour-coded mop to prevent cross-contamination.
  5. Empty rubbish bins, clean them with a disinfectant wipe, and replace liners.
  6. Clean glass surfaces with a glass cleaner and a lint-free cloth to avoid streaks.
  7. Inspect the area to ensure all tasks are completed to the required standard.

Quality Criteria

Performance Level Criteria
Excellent All surfaces are free of dust and marks; high-touch areas are sanitised with no visible residue; floors are spotless and dry; rubbish bins are clean and odour-free; glass surfaces are streak-free.
Good Minor dust on less accessible surfaces; high-touch areas are mostly sanitised; floors have minimal marks; rubbish bins are clean but may have slight odour; glass surfaces have minor streaks.
Pass Noticeable dust on surfaces; some high-touch areas missed; floors have visible marks; rubbish bins are not entirely clean; glass surfaces have visible streaks.
Fail Significant dust accumulation; high-touch areas not sanitised; floors are dirty; rubbish bins are overflowing or have strong odour; glass surfaces are dirty.
